Step-by-step explanation:

There are a total of 15 bulbs to choose from randomly. First a new bulb is chosen. Chance is 9/15 because 9 out of 15 are new.

Then there are only 14 bulbs left. Then a used bulb is chosen. Chance is 6/14 since 6 out of remaining 14 are used.

Total chance for this to happen is 9/15 * 6/14 = 54/210 = 9/35.
